Data-driven disease progression model of Parkinson's disease and effect of sex and genetic variants.
CPT: pharmacometrics & systems pharmacology - 1 Apr 2024
Jin Ryota, Yoshioka Hideki, Sato Hiromi, Hisaka Akihiro
Abstract excerpt
As Parkinson's disease (PD) progresses, there are multiple biomarker changes, and sex and genetic variants may influence the rate of progression. Data-driven, long-term disease progression model analysis may provide precise knowledge of the relationships between these risk factors and progression and would allow for the selection of appropriate diagnosis and treatment according to disease progression.
